Fresh Bay Leaves

Fresh bay leaves are aromatic leaves from the bay laurel tree, commonly used in cooking for their distinctive flavor and fragrance. They are rich in essential oils and have been used in traditional medicine for their potential health benefits.

Bay leaves contain compounds that may help reduce inflammation and improve digestion.
They are rich in antioxidants, which can help protect the body from oxidative stress.

Banana

Bananas are a popular tropical fruit known for their sweet taste and soft texture. They are rich in essential nutrients, particularly potassium and vitamin B6, making them a great energy source.

Bananas are an excellent source of potassium, which helps regulate blood pressure and supports heart health.
They contain dietary fiber, which aids in digestion and helps maintain a healthy gut.
